English: Repro painting of the family of the Duke of Penthièvre sat in front of his son the Prince of Lamballe with his wife and daughter Mademoiselle de Penthièvre and the Dukes mother, the widowed comtesse de Toulouse.
Français : Portrait de groupe représentant le duc de Penthièvre (1725-1793) en compagnie de son fils le prince de Lamballe (1747-1768), de sa belle-fille Marie Thèrèse Louise (1749-1792), princesse de Lamballe, avec son chien, de sa fille Louise Marie Adelaïde dite "Mademoiselle" de Penthièvre (1753-1821), future duchesse d'Orléans et de sa mère Marie-Victoire (1688-1766), comtesse de Toulouse.
